[PATCH v4 0/6] Support SDHCI and eMMC for ast2700

Jamin Lin via posted 6 patches 5 months ago
hw/arm/aspeed_ast2400.c      |  3 +-
hw/arm/aspeed_ast2600.c      | 10 +++---
hw/arm/aspeed_ast27x0.c      | 35 +++++++++++++++++++
hw/sd/aspeed_sdhci.c         | 67 ++++++++++++++++++++++++++++++++++--
include/hw/sd/aspeed_sdhci.h | 13 +++++--
5 files changed, 117 insertions(+), 11 deletions(-)
[PATCH v4 0/6] Support SDHCI and eMMC for ast2700
Posted by Jamin Lin via 5 months ago
change from v1:
This patch series do not support boot from an eMMC.
Only support eMMC and SD Slot 0 as storages.

change from v2:
- Add hw/sd/aspeed_sdhci: Fix coding style patch

change from v3:
- Directly set capareg and sd_spec_version instead of property
- Keep DEFINE_TYPES

change from v4:
- Keep to set capareg and sd_spec_version by property

Jamin Lin (6):
  hw/sd/aspeed_sdhci: Fix coding style
  hw/arm/aspeed: Fix coding style
  hw:sdhci: Introduce a new "capareg" class member to set the different
    Capability Registers
  hw/sd/aspeed_sdhci: Add AST2700 Support
  aspeed/soc: Support SDHCI for AST2700
  aspeed/soc: Support eMMC for AST2700

 hw/arm/aspeed_ast2400.c      |  3 +-
 hw/arm/aspeed_ast2600.c      | 10 +++---
 hw/arm/aspeed_ast27x0.c      | 35 +++++++++++++++++++
 hw/sd/aspeed_sdhci.c         | 67 ++++++++++++++++++++++++++++++++++--
 include/hw/sd/aspeed_sdhci.h | 13 +++++--
 5 files changed, 117 insertions(+), 11 deletions(-)

-- 
2.34.1
Re: [PATCH v4 0/6] Support SDHCI and eMMC for ast2700
Posted by Cédric Le Goater 4 months, 4 weeks ago
On 12/4/24 09:44, Jamin Lin wrote:
> change from v1:
> This patch series do not support boot from an eMMC.
> Only support eMMC and SD Slot 0 as storages.
> 
> change from v2:
> - Add hw/sd/aspeed_sdhci: Fix coding style patch
> 
> change from v3:
> - Directly set capareg and sd_spec_version instead of property
> - Keep DEFINE_TYPES
> 
> change from v4:
> - Keep to set capareg and sd_spec_version by property
> 
> Jamin Lin (6):
>    hw/sd/aspeed_sdhci: Fix coding style
>    hw/arm/aspeed: Fix coding style
>    hw:sdhci: Introduce a new "capareg" class member to set the different
>      Capability Registers
>    hw/sd/aspeed_sdhci: Add AST2700 Support
>    aspeed/soc: Support SDHCI for AST2700
>    aspeed/soc: Support eMMC for AST2700
> 
>   hw/arm/aspeed_ast2400.c      |  3 +-
>   hw/arm/aspeed_ast2600.c      | 10 +++---
>   hw/arm/aspeed_ast27x0.c      | 35 +++++++++++++++++++
>   hw/sd/aspeed_sdhci.c         | 67 ++++++++++++++++++++++++++++++++++--
>   include/hw/sd/aspeed_sdhci.h | 13 +++++--
>   5 files changed, 117 insertions(+), 11 deletions(-)
> 


Applied to aspeed-next.

Thanks,

C.